theLinktoLearn Investor Relations Manager Salary

The average theLinktoLearn Investor Relations Manager earns an estimated $87,491 annually. theLinktoLearn's Investor Relations Manager compensation is $188 more than the US average for a Investor Relations Manager.

The Communications Department at theLinktoLearn earns $18,668 more on average than the Customer Support Department.

Investor Relations Manager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Investor Relations Manager at companies similar size to theLinktoLearn reported making $113,250, while the average male Investor Relations Manager at similar sized companies reported making $68,100.

Investor Relations Manager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Caucasian Investor Relations Manager at companies similar size to theLinktoLearn reported making $102,750, while the average African American/Black Investor Relations Manager at similar sized companies reported making $76,200.
